Do Sex Dolls Really Sweat or Get Warm? Here’s What You Need to Know
Can sex dolls actually sweat or get warm? The blunt answer is no; they don’t have biological functions like humans do, but some materials can feel warm to the touch.
- Sex dolls do not perspire or generate heat.
- Some materials may mimic warmth, but it’s superficial.
- Heat retention can be an option with electric dolls.
Understanding Sex Doll Materials

- Silicone: Not prone to sweating, but can feel warm.
- TPE (Thermoplastic Elastomer): Also does not sweat, may imitate warmth better.
Do Electric Dolls Get Warm?
Some sex dolls come equipped with heaters:
- These dolls use built-in heating elements.
- They can provide a warm sensation, mimicking body heat.
- Adjustable settings are common for personalized warmth.
Maintaining Your Doll’s Temperature

- Store in a moderate climate to avoid overheating.
- Consider using external warming blankets if desired.
- Avoid direct sunlight to prevent material degradation.
Frequently Asked Questions
Can I make my doll feel warmer? Yes, use heated blankets or buy models that have warming functions.
Is there any maintenance needed for heat features? Regularly check electrical components for safety.
Will the doll feel cold in winter? Yes, materials like silicone can feel cold; insulating covers might help.
